Solution for 5a-8(a-2)=-2(-4a+3) equation:


Simplifying
5a + -8(a + -2) = -2(-4a + 3)

Reorder the terms:
5a + -8(-2 + a) = -2(-4a + 3)
5a + (-2 * -8 + a * -8) = -2(-4a + 3)
5a + (16 + -8a) = -2(-4a + 3)

Reorder the terms:
16 + 5a + -8a = -2(-4a + 3)

Combine like terms: 5a + -8a = -3a
16 + -3a = -2(-4a + 3)

Reorder the terms:
16 + -3a = -2(3 + -4a)
16 + -3a = (3 * -2 + -4a * -2)
16 + -3a = (-6 + 8a)

Solving
16 + -3a = -6 + 8a

Solving for variable 'a'.

Move all terms containing a to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-8a' to each side of the equation.
16 + -3a + -8a = -6 + 8a + -8a

Combine like terms: -3a + -8a = -11a
16 + -11a = -6 + 8a + -8a

Combine like terms: 8a + -8a = 0
16 + -11a = -6 + 0
16 + -11a = -6

Add '-16' to each side of the equation.
16 + -16 + -11a = -6 + -16

Combine like terms: 16 + -16 = 0
0 + -11a = -6 + -16
-11a = -6 + -16

Combine like terms: -6 + -16 = -22
-11a = -22

Divide each side by '-11'.
a = 2

Simplifying
a = 2
